Mental Health Conditions and Lab Testing
Mental health conditions can be challenging to diagnose because they often rely on subjective symptoms reported by patients. In addition to psychological evaluations and interviews with Healthcare Providers, laboratory tests can also play a role in diagnosing mental health conditions. By analyzing various physiological markers in the body, these tests can provide valuable information to assist in identifying and managing mental health disorders.
Common Lab Tests for Mental Health Conditions
Several types of lab tests are commonly used to diagnose mental health conditions:
- Blood Tests: Blood tests can provide valuable insights into the body's overall health and functioning. Some common blood tests used in the diagnosis of mental health conditions include:
- Thyroid Function Tests: Thyroid hormones play a crucial role in regulating mood and energy levels. Abnormal thyroid function can contribute to symptoms of anxiety and depression.
- Metabolic Panels: These tests evaluate various markers, such as electrolyte levels and kidney function, which can impact mental health.
- Complete Blood Count (CBC): Anemia and other blood disorders can lead to symptoms of fatigue and mood disturbances.
- Urine Tests: Urine tests can also provide valuable information about an individual's overall health and potential contributors to mental health symptoms. Some common urine tests used in mental health diagnosis include drug screening tests to rule out substance abuse.
- Neurotransmitter Testing: Neurotransmitters are chemicals in the brain that play a role in regulating mood and behavior. Testing neurotransmitter levels can provide insights into imbalances that may contribute to mental health conditions.
- Genetic Testing: Genetic Testing can identify specific genetic variations associated with mental health disorders. Understanding an individual's genetic predispositions can help guide treatment decisions and improve outcomes.
The Role of Phlebotomists in Laboratory Testing
Phlebotomists are skilled healthcare professionals trained in drawing blood samples from patients for laboratory testing. They play a crucial role in the diagnostic process by ensuring that samples are collected accurately and efficiently. In the context of mental health conditions, phlebotomists may collect blood samples for various tests, including those mentioned above.
Phlebotomists must follow strict protocols to ensure the integrity of samples and maintain patient safety. By carefully labeling and processing samples, phlebotomists help ensure that Test Results are accurate and reliable. This attention to detail is essential in diagnosing mental health conditions and guiding appropriate treatment strategies for patients.
